C. Rabarivola is a scholar working on Social Psychology, Global and Planetary Change and Ecology. According to data from OpenAlex, C. Rabarivola has authored 21 papers receiving a total of 400 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Social Psychology, 11 papers in Global and Planetary Change and 7 papers in Ecology. Recurrent topics in C. Rabarivola’s work include Primate Behavior and Ecology (12 papers), Amphibian and Reptile Biology (11 papers) and Animal Behavior and Reproduction (4 papers). C. Rabarivola is often cited by papers focused on Primate Behavior and Ecology (12 papers), Amphibian and Reptile Biology (11 papers) and Animal Behavior and Reproduction (4 papers). C. Rabarivola collaborates with scholars based in France, Portugal and Switzerland. C. Rabarivola's co-authors include Lounès Chikhi, Brigitte Crouau‐Roy, Erwan Quéméré, Y. Rumpler, Edward E. Louis, Emmanuel Rasolondraibe, Cristina Giacoma, Marco Gamba, Jordi Salmona and Nicole Andriaholinirina and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Molecular Ecology and American Journal of Physical Anthropology.
